Output 87af95f65e21a3c5419ea31b039d06365a77d517e23e95ce44ed5ca965286257:0

value
80413
script pubkey
OP_0 OP_PUSHBYTES_20 032e7b6847163f863fdb1dcef1981b60df2a958a
address
bc1qqvh8k6z8zclcv07mrh80rxqmvr0j49v2pqa872
transaction
87af95f65e21a3c5419ea31b039d06365a77d517e23e95ce44ed5ca965286257
confirmations
18439
spent
true